Material Performance: Matching Packaging to Food Type

Street food packaging must handle diverse thermal and moisture conditions without compromising food quality. The material selection should align with your menu requirements:

Hot and Saucy Foods

For curries, rice bowls, noodle dishes, and other high-temperature items with liquid content, packaging must provide thermal insulation and leak resistance. Double-wall paper bowls with vented lids, aluminum foil containers, and PP injection-molded bowls with secure-lock lids are common solutions. Fried and Crispy Foods

Fried items present a distinct challenge: moisture trapped inside packaging quickly degrades texture. Grease-resistant kraft paperboard, clamshell boxes with ventilation cutouts, and open-top trays with food-grade wax linings help maintain crispness. Cold Foods and Beverages

Salads, cold desserts, and chilled drinks require packaging that maintains temperature and prevents condensation issues. Clear PET or PP containers with tight-sealing lids work well for visual appeal and portion clarity. For beverage cups, double-wall and ripple-wall constructions provide insulation while protecting hands from cold transfer.

Sustainability: Navigating Market Expectations

Environmental considerations increasingly influence packaging selection, particularly in European and North American markets. However, "sustainable" packaging encompasses multiple approaches—not all suitable for every application:

  • Compostable materials (bagasse, PLA, paperboard) decompose under industrial composting conditions but may have temperature and moisture limitations for hot, oily foods.
  • Recyclable mono-materials (PP, PET) support circular material flows where collection and recycling infrastructure exists.
  • Recycled content reduces virgin material demand, though food-contact applications have strict purity requirements.
